What Causes This Problem
- Electrical malfunctions can ignite fires and cause damage to belongings.
- Cooking accidents are a common source of fire-related content damages.
- Candle misuse often results in unexpected blaze incidents.
- Heating appliances left unattended can lead to serious fires.
- Poorly maintained chimneys can also cause significant fire hazards.

Service Cost In Garden City
Fire-damaged contents cleaning typically ranges from $500 to $5,000 based on the extent of damage and the number of items requiring restoration.
